解锁Zed编辑器的无限可能:5种插件使用场景全解析
【免费下载链接】zedZed 是由 Atom 和 Tree-sitter 的创造者开发的一款高性能、多人协作代码编辑器。项目地址: https://gitcode.com/GitHub_Trending/ze/zed
Zed作为新一代高性能代码编辑器,其插件生态系统为用户提供了丰富的功能扩展。与传统的插件管理方式不同,Zed的插件生态采用模块化设计,让开发者能够根据具体需求灵活配置。
场景一:前端开发者的完美搭档 🎨
对于前端开发者来说,Zed的插件支持简直是量身定制。HTML插件不仅提供基础的语法高亮,还支持智能标签补全和属性提示,大大提升了开发效率。
必备插件组合:
- HTML插件:标签自动闭合和格式化
- 样式检查工具:实时代码质量反馈
- 代码片段扩展:自定义常用模板
实用技巧:在开发过程中,合理配置代码片段可以节省大量重复劳动时间。
场景二:游戏开发的强力助手 🎮
GLSL插件为游戏开发者提供了专业的着色语言支持。从语法高亮到错误检查,这个插件覆盖了OpenGL开发的各个环节。
场景三:API开发的高效工具 ⚡
Protocol Buffers插件让API开发变得更加顺畅。它不仅支持.proto文件的语法解析,还能提供智能补全功能。
配置示例:
# 安装Proto插件 zed extensions install proto场景四:团队协作的智能方案 🤝
在多人协作场景下,Zed的插件生态表现出色。通过合理配置,可以实现代码风格的统一和开发效率的提升。
场景五:个性化定制的艺术创作 🎨
主题和图标插件让每个开发者都能打造属于自己的专属工作环境。从配色方案到文件图标,每一个细节都可以自定义。
推荐配置:
- 选择适合长时间编码的主题
- 配置清晰的文件图标系统
- 设置个性化的代码高亮
插件管理的最佳实践
- 渐进式安装:不要一次性安装所有插件,根据项目需求逐步添加
- 定期清理:及时卸载不再使用的插件
- 版本控制:确保插件与编辑器版本兼容
开发者的进阶之路
对于想要深度定制Zed的开发者,官方提供了完善的开发文档。通过docs/src/extensions.md可以了解详细的插件开发流程。
开发建议:
- 从简单的功能扩展开始
- 参考现有插件的实现方式
- 充分利用扩展API的功能
通过这五个典型场景的深度解析,相信你已经对Zed插件生态有了更全面的认识。无论是前端开发、游戏制作还是团队协作,Zed都能通过其强大的插件系统为你提供最佳解决方案。
记住,好的工具配置应该服务于你的工作流程,而不是反过来。选择适合自己需求的插件组合,让Zed成为你编程路上的得力助手!
【免费下载链接】zedZed 是由 Atom 和 Tree-sitter 的创造者开发的一款高性能、多人协作代码编辑器。项目地址: https://gitcode.com/GitHub_Trending/ze/zed
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考